Meet Sampson
Sampson is a 6-month-old handsome boy looking for his forever home.
Sampson is a big baby. He likes to be held and cuddled constantly. He is very clingy. His favorite thing is sleep inside his foster mom's robe like a kangaroo in a pouch.
Sampson is a playful kitten, but mostly wants to be with you and see everything you are doing. He has a pretty low energy vibe for a kitten. He spends his day laying by or on his foster mom. He has been exposed to cats, dogs, and kids under 2—he is a bit nervous and would prefer a lower energy household. He does wrestle other kittens in the house but usually does not initiate play.
Sampson does very well in the litter box and has not had an accident outside of his box. However, due to his long hair, he will need some sanitary grooming.
Sampson's current living situation is in a home with 2 adults, 1 toddler, 2 dogs, 3 resident cats, and 2 other foster cats. His ideal home would be a chill, quiet environment where someone is home most of the time. He came from a rough situation, so he needs extra comfort and attention. It would be really great if his forever family could work on building his confidence, so he can be a fearless curious cat.
Due to his young age, Sampson needs to be adopted with another young cat or go to a home with a furry companion.
